1 Ranking Barriers to Implementing Marketing Plans in the Food Industry Shahram Gilaninia 1, Seyed Yahya Seyed Danesh 2, Mina Abroofarakh 3* 1 Department of Industrial Management, Rasht Branch, Islamic Azad University, Rasht, Iran, 2 Payam Noor University of Rasht Branch, Iran, 3* M.A. Student of Business Management, Rasht Branch, Islamic Azad University, Rasht, Iran Abstract The purpose of research is ranking barriers of Marketing Plan. This article is based on field research in companies operating in the food industry of Guilan To develop theoretical framework and research model is used the model proposed by Simkin (2002). In this research after studying library and performing exploratory interviews, set of as barriers to effective planning, plans and marketing strategies have proposed and influence in medium and large businesses, determine and through field research and tool of questionnaires were evaluated. Then by using a questionnaire is measured each component that in final model of the implementation barriers of marketing plans designed, Such as 1 - Conceptual, 2 - Operational Factors, 3 - Strategic Factors, 4 - Relationship Factors, 5 - Management Factors 6 - Human Resources Factors And 7 - Cultural Factors. Structural equation modeling and LISREL software is used to investigate the relationships between the components and finally verification of the components relationship in conceptual model is confirmed. According to the studies done about companies operating in the food industry in Guilan province, there are a total of 490 companies in this section. The sample size was estimated 215 by using Cochran formula. Sampling method was probability sampling (randomly). The tool of research is questionnaire. Reliability of questionnaire with Cronbach's alpha coefficient by using SPSS software was calculated 87/5. In This research for investigate validity was used "content validity" and "construct validity. In content validity of research questionnaire was used views of 15 experts (including a number of university professors and experts in the food industry). In construct validity (conceptual) to ensure construct validity was used factor analysis. Results are expressed that questionnaire, a total of 7 with total variance explained with higher than 70/97% has been able to measure the " barriers to implementing marketing plans in companies operating in the food industry of Guilan province ". This indicates good construct validity of questions. 37

Therefore it can be stated that improving dimension of operational in desired society with the 95% confidence level is caused to resolve barriers to implementing marketing plans in companies operating in the food industry of Guilan b) Mean test: in mean test because significant level is lower than 5% for operational, H 0 hypothesis is rejected in 95% confidence level and condition of this factor in the company s operating is estimated desirable in the food industry of Guilan Question (3): What is ranking of barriers to the effective implementation of marketing plan based on order of importance? Based on model of estimating standard in method of structural equation modeling, priority components of the model of "barriers to the effective implementation of marketing plans," respectively is "conceptual" (path coefficient 0.84), "operational" (path coefficient 0.81), "strategic" (path coefficient 0.77), 'communication' (path coefficient 0.75), "Managerial" (path coefficient 0.65), "human Resources" (path coefficient 0.56), and "culture" (path coefficient 0.50).
